뇌를 자극하는 윈도우즈 시스템 프로그래밍(윤성우)
6장. 커널 오브젝트에 대한 이해
리소스는 그 리소스를 생성한 프로그램에서 관리한다.
리소스(파이프, 프로세스, 쓰레드)를 생성할 때 커널 오브젝트도 함께 생성된다.
커널 오브젝트는 OS에서 관리한다.
커널 오브젝트의 주소나 포인터를 우리는 알 수 없다. 대신 커널 오브젝트의 고유번호(식별자)인 핸들(Handle)을 가지고
특정 커널 오브젝트를 가리킬 수 있다. 또한 함수 파라미터로 특정 커널 오브젝트를 전달 할 수 있게 된다.
+ Reference
이 포스팅은
윤성우 강사님의 뇌를 자극하는 윈도우즈 시스템 프로그래밍 책과
youtube 강의로 공부한 내용을 개인적으로 정리한 것입니다.
|
youtube 강의 링크 : https://youtu.be/tYs6q_Lsi_0?list=PLVsNizTWUw7E2KrfnsyEjTqo-6uKiQoxc